The Boss fall short of expectations, succumb to ATL Steel Town, 109.00-99.86

There's no way around it, The Boss underdelivered, at least based on projections, as ATL Steel Town came out on top with a 109.00-99.86 victory. The Boss nabbed a 33.70-point lead on Thursday behind 37.9 points from Dallas Goedert (8 Rec, 100 Rec Yds, 1 Rec TD) and Dameon Pierce (139 Rush Yds). But ATL Steel Town held the lead the rest of the way, powered by Cooper Kupp (26.8 points) and Jaylen Waddle (19.5). ATL Steel Town (4-5) will look to notch another win against Action Jackson, while The Boss (4-5) meet Money In The Bank in an effort to right the ship.
